Mountain Anoa vs Mountain Coati
Bubalus quarlesi compared with Nasua olivacea
Key Differences
- Mountain Anoa is Endangered while Mountain Coati is Vulnerable.
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Mountain Anoa | Mountain Coati |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Mammals)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) | Carnivora (Carnivorans) |
| Family | Bovidae (Bovids) | Procyonidae (Raccoons) |
| Genus | Bubalus | Nasua |
| Species | Bubalus quarlesi | Nasua olivacea |
Evolutionary Relationship
Mountain Anoa and Mountain Coati share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
